  • Joehancock try a chromatic for motown. Stevie Wonder style. Takes more practice but ultimately MUCH BETTER than a diatonic. Can play Jazz as well as blues. Diatonic is only for blues and country style music. Chromatic has a button and plays all styles of music, however, doesn't bend as easy as diatonic harps. This guy plays diatonic. Listen to Paul Butterfield, Magic Dick, Lee Oscar, practice with early Stones tunes. Start with b flat, G, A and F for easy bends.

  • I found the same info from Blues books in the late 70's. I tried and WRONG idea. If you boil a "wooden" Marine Band Harp, the wood will swell outside the playing area and only option is to SHAVE the wood down. I never thought that harp was any LOOSER. Nowdays you buy a Special-20 which is Pre-Bent! So easy to bend a cord! and others are available. Look at the best harp vids. YOU SEE BLACK NOT WOOD. These are Special 20's! There Great!!

  • riecket... not an overblow; he's just scooping the 2 draw full bend up to the natural 2 draw. It is a cool sound.

    For what it's worth, you don't usually use overblows on the lower octave; they're most effective in the middle octave to get those missing blue notes.
